Global Locate
Handset and mobile wireless device manufacturers worldwide select Global Locate IndoorGPS® semiconductor solutions to achieve the small footprint, low cost and ultra-low power consumption required for A-GPS implementations.
Their solutions meet the most rigorous Mobile Operator A-GPS performance requirements for E911, E112, Navigation, Autonomous, Location-enabled services, and Location-based services (LES/LBS) applications.
The Parthenon Group
The Parthenon Group is the strategic advisor of choice for CEOs and business leaders worldwide. Founded in 1991 as a strategy advisory and principal investing firm, the company has over 150 members in 2007, in offices in Boston, London, and San Francisco
Their client mix includes Global 1000 corporations, high-potential growth companies, private equity clients, educational clients and non-profits.
As a founding partner in Strategic Value Capital, a small and mid-cap hedge fund, they are positioned to assist their clients in funding when needed.
Pou Chen Corporation
Pou Chen Corporation was founded in September 1969 with canvas and rubber footwear as their major products initially. Thereafter, Pou Chen focused on athletic and casual footwear manufacturing.
By the late 1970s, Pou Chen began to produce athletic footwear on an original equipment manufacturer (OEM) basis for the branded company, "adidas". With the professional R&D ability and experienced factory management, Pou Chen successfully turned to be an original design manufacture (ODM) from a simply OEM. Pou Chen via its major subsidiary, Yue Yuen Industrial (Holdings) Ltd. ("Yue Yuen", http://www.yueyuen.com), expanded production bases to China, Indonesia, Vietnam, United States and Mexico in the 1980s.
Currently, the company manufactures athletic and casual footwear on an OEM/ODM basis for major global brand such as Nike, adidas, Asics, Reebok, Puma, New Balance, Merrell, Timberland, Converse, and Salomon. At the end of 2006, 376 production lines were running daily and its annual production was nearly 200 million pairs of shoes.
